Monolith Series - Chamber BookendMonolith Series, created by Rodrigo Bravo, are carved from single pieces of Combarbalita, a volcanic stone only found in his native Chile. Its heterogeneous composition of different minerals allows it to produce a wide variety of colors. Monoliths are the result of the symbiosis of contemporary design and traditional craftsmanship. ##details## Dimensions: 3. 5" x H 6. 5" x2 Handmade in Chile.
